The Goose Eggs

a group of four kids, one girl and three boys. one boy is holding a baseball bat.

FIRST APPEARANCE:

Austin – March 11, 1977
Ruby – March 11, 1977
Leland – March 17, 1977
Milo – March 18, 1977

Charlie Brown met the Goose Eggs after he ran away from home and was knocked out by a foul ball hit by pint-sized slugger, Ruby. When these younger kids, Austin, Leland, Milo, and Ruby, learn that Charlie Brown plays baseball, and is even a team manager, they ask him to coach their team. When Ruby learns some baseball terminology, specifically that “goose egg” means zero, she proudly announces that’s what they’ll call their team, “The Goose Eggs!” Charlie Brown decides to help them out and begins coaching them on the fundamentals of the game. He turns out to be a good and respected coach—something he’s not in his own neighborhood. The Goose Eggs even win their very first game… when the other team forfeited because of their age. But still, a win is a win.

The Goose Eggs are the smallest baseball team in the neighborhood.
